赞
踩
在现今的企业开发中,我们都是会使用到git
进行团队开发,因为我们知道,有些人的能力很大,可以胜任一个公司的很多职位,但你的时间和精力有限,不能够对多个事情进行同步的工作,当然并不是所有人都有这个能力,所以我们每个人最好还是各司其职,完成好自己的那一部分工作,任何一个项目的正式发行,都是几个团队成功合作开发的结果,还是那句话,团队的力量是无限的,个人的力量是有限的,所以企业开发git
就顺应而生,话不多说,咱们上教程。
1、首先,你的电脑必须有git的搭载的环境,就比如我的二手电脑去年刚买,它搭载window11系统,自带git,到现在的时段,应该每台搭载有window11的电脑应该都有搭载git,你可以尝试在主页点右键单击,如下图所示:
两个git开头的就是我们电脑搭载系统自带的。
Git Bash:Unix与Linux风格的命令行,使用最多,推荐最多
Git GUI:图形界面的Git,不建议初学者使用,尽量先熟悉常用命令。
如果没有,可以去https://git-scm.com/
官网下载。
然后就是我们注册一个gitee账号,这个我就不多说,傻瓜式
的注册登录。
进去之后我们可以点击我们头像,然后点击设置
然后我们不着急,当你安装Git后首先要做的事情是设置你的用户名称和e-mail地址。
这是非常重要的,因为每次Git提交都会使用该信息。它被永远的嵌入到了你的提交中:
只需要做一次这个设置,如果你传递了–global 选项,因为Git将总是会使用该信息来处理你在系统中所
做的一切操作。如果你希望在一个特定的项目中使用不同的名称或e-mail地址,你可以在该项目中运行
该命令而不要–global选项。 总之–global为全局配置,不加为某个项目的特定配置。
git config --global user.name "xiaoqin" #名称
git config --global user.email 3265456756@qq.com #邮箱
然后进行秘钥的添加,记住当我们打开到自己用户文件夹管理员文件夹这个界面的时候如图,需要改变以下文件的查看模式,要把查看隐藏模式打开,
打开git bash,使用git命令。
生产密钥,命令如下。
ssh-keygen -t rsa -C “邮箱名称”
(首先 ssh-keygen 会确认 密钥的存储位置(默认是 .ssh/id_rsa),然后它会要求你输入两次密钥口令。 如果你不想在使用密钥时输入口令,将其留空即可。
然而,如果你使用了密码,那么请确保添加了 -o 选项,它会以比默认格式更能抗暴力破解的格式保存私钥。 你也可以用 ssh-agent 工具来避免每次都要输入密码)。
查看密钥,命令如下。
cd ~/.ssh
输出密钥,命令如下。
cat id_rsa.pub
复制密钥,打开给gitee,点击自己头像settings>>ssh Keys>>在key添加密钥。
title设置自己的名称。
然后当你配置好之后,可以先创建本地仓库啦。
创建本地仓库的方法有两种:
一种是创建全新的仓库,另一种是克隆远程仓库。
1、创建全新的仓库,需要用GIT管理的项目的根目录执行:
# 在当前目录新建一个Git代码库
$ git init
我们先在本地随便添加构建一个文件夹,如图,gitqin文件夹
然后进去右键单击Git Bush Here
出现此页面
输入上述git init命令出现以下结果,如果看到文件夹.git生成了,就说明你创造本地仓库成功啦!
2、另一种方式是克隆远程目录,由于是将远程服务器上的仓库完全镜像一份至本地!
我们点击gitee进行一个新建仓库
然后它自动给你跳到创建的云仓库界面
然后我们点击复制仓库链接
然后我们再回到本地找到刚才创建文件夹,再创建一个文件夹(也可以不建文件夹,这里我是为了给友友们讲解对比明显,才新构建一个文件夹的)
点击进去执行下面的命令
$ git clone [url]
然后我们就可以看到我们再gitee仓库构建的东西了,全部被克隆下来了。
然后我们可以通过以下的命令进行查看其状态。
上面说文件有4种状态,通过如下命令可以查看到文件的状态:
#查看指定文件状态
git status [filename]
#查看所有文件状态
git status
然后我们用IDEA创建一个SpringBoot项目,进行实验
我们可以先打开IDEA最下面的版本控制,可以看到我们仓库的所有信息,如图
新版2023.1IDEA提交到暂存区的操作是如图在左边边框,老版的应该在右上角,如图:
在这里面进行添加
然后我们还要再进行push到远程仓库,也可以在上述页面中的commit旁边的按钮(commit and push)直接到远程仓库,我们也可以在控制台输出命令git push也行如图:
我们刷新页面,就可以看到我们本地上传的文件啦!(我记得如果你是第一次上传文件,你可能在IDEA页面就要输入gitee的密码哦,友友们记得记住自己的gitee的密码哦)
如果再在项目里面创建了新的文件可以进行如下操作
然后执行之前几步,最后控制台输入git push 就可以上传到远程仓库啦。
谢谢友友的鼎力支持啊,以上也有很多的不足,还请友友们见谅啊。
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。